Souk Semmarine

Main covered souk of Marrakech medina

Souk Semmarine is the main artery of the Marrakech medina markets, running from Jemaa el-Fnaa north toward the Ben Youssef Mosque. Covered with a reed-and-wood canopy, it follows the medieval city plan and feeds dozens of smaller specialist souks — Nejjarine for woodwork, Haddadine for ironwork, Chouari for basketry, Rahba Kedima for apothecary stalls.
